Output 526be153708c96d2f62524cad61dc3a96f22c07c6a20171e4d812d3d51086ec4:0

value
1160827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6e1959f231c71dcfe67b15498c4dc4fbc00bd8 OP_EQUAL
address
3DDWxXdrJS4Lv3LPZAyhvm41HuXiG9Rm31
transaction
526be153708c96d2f62524cad61dc3a96f22c07c6a20171e4d812d3d51086ec4